How much dividend does Steelcase 2025 pay?

According to the latest status from February 2025, Steelcase paid a total of 0.5 USD per share in dividends within the last 12 months. With the current Steelcase price of 12.15 USD, this corresponds to a dividend yield of 4.12 %. A dividend is paid times per year.

Is the Steelcase Dividend Safe?

Steelcase has been increasing the dividend for 1 years.

Over the past 10 years, Steelcase has increased it by an annual 1.759 %.

Over a five-year period, the distribution increased by -2.925%.

Analysts expect a Dividend Cut of -1.886% for the current fiscal year.

What does Steelcase do?

Steelcase Inc is a leading manufacturer of office furniture and furnishings based in Grand Rapids, Michigan. The company was founded in 1912 by cousins Peter Martin Wege and Walter D. Idema and now has over 11,000 employees worldwide in 80 countries. Steelcase is one of the most popular companies on Eulerpool.com.
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
